SDI Advanced Diver
This course certifies you to dive as deep as 130 ft. The SDI Advanced Diver course signifies you are truly an Advanced Diver. It included 4 specialties, typically Nitrox, Deep, Underwater Navigation, and Night/Limited Visibility. Once you have completed 4 specialties and have a minimum of 25 dives experience, you will be certified as an SDI Advanced Diver.

Computer Nitrox Specialty
Book online now!This course will certify you to dive with EANx (Enriched Air Nitrox) up to a max 40% oxygen mix. This gives you more bottom time and shorter required surface intervals.
